This came from our bank just a bit ago.
“On March 11, 2021, the Treasury Department and the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) announced the distribution of a third round of economic impact payments to help Americans combat the financial effects of the COVID-19 pandemic. Please be aware that although the Treasury began distributions of this third round of economic impact payments starting today, the funds will be deposited into your account based on the stated effective date of these payments. It is our understanding, that the first of these payments will be effective March 17, 2021.”
